Output 598ca2b60eebfc3eb2cbdf02d9ea885bd7269b3364cfdba2aa9daec4c50e5f07:14

value
64291
script pubkey
OP_0 OP_PUSHBYTES_20 ec8e6d744f1a3fc99cb89c899c67d364d9859c25
address
bc1qaj8x6az0rglun89cnjyece7nvnvct8p9vtpwvt
transaction
598ca2b60eebfc3eb2cbdf02d9ea885bd7269b3364cfdba2aa9daec4c50e5f07
spent
false